For those planning a trip to New York to take in a Broadway show, be advised, the rules are changing.
Most Broadway theatres have decided to stop checking the vaccination status of ticket holders as of April 30th but will continue to require that audience members wear masks inside theatres through at least May 31.
The Broadway League says since last fall, over five million people have seen a Broadway show, and the safety and security of cast, crew, and audience has been the top priority. League President Charlotte St. Martin says by maintaining strict audience masking through at least the month of May, they’ll continue the track record of safety for all.
In Toronto, Mirvish Theatres still require audience members to be masked. No word on when that might be lifted.
